Talis image

Talis is a book about the card game of the same name.

Description Icon.png

This book is redolent with the enticing smell of paper and ink.

Properties

  • Books
  • Rarity: Common
  •  Weight: 0.5 kg / 1 lb
  • Price: 14 gp


Where to find

Text

[Featuring a deck of 70-78 cards, Talis occupies a place alongside chess and draughts as one of those games that carbuncular gentlemen play over warming mugs of ale at the back of taverns, or over vile flavourless biscuits in the dining room corner at every major familial celebration, including birthdays.


It is a deck allowing the player access to games of vast strategic depth involving four suits and one trump suit called the Major Arcana. These games include whist, poker, elemental empires, old wizard, and let's-just- make-a-card-tower-I-can-hardly-see-I've-had-that-many-pints-lads.]
